How does supply chain management work?
SCM involves multiple phases that must be efficiently managed to ensure a continuous flow of products and services. These phases include planning, sourcing raw materials, production, storage, and distribution. Comprehensive logistics plays a fundamental role in this process, as it coordinates each of these links to ensure the product arrives on time at its final destination.
In an increasingly globalized environment, managing the supply chain has become more complex due to the number of variables involved, such as suppliers from different countries, local regulations, and changes in market demand. This is where logistic warehousing comes into play, one of the critical areas in the supply chain that focuses on optimizing the handling and storage of products, ensuring they are available when needed while minimizing inventory costs.

The benefits of optimizing the supply chain
Implementing an efficient supply chain management strategy allows you to optimize every stage of the supply chain. This results in several key benefits, such as cost reduction, greater operational efficiency, and, most importantly, a better customer experience. Below, we explain some of the most prominent benefits:
- Cost reduction: By integrating all logistics processes under a single strategy, you can identify inefficient areas that are generating additional costs. For example, proper use of logistics storage allows you to minimize inventory expenses through techniques like just-in-time, which reduces the amount of stored products without sacrificing responsiveness to demand.
- Operational efficiency: An optimized SCM ensures that all resources are used in the most effective way possible. This includes not only physical resources like transportation and warehouses but also human resources. By properly managing comprehensive logistics, you ensure that products move through the supply chain without interruptions, avoiding delays and unnecessary losses.
- Improved customer satisfaction: Today’s customers value speed and reliability in deliveries. A well-executed supply chain management allows you to meet these expectations, ensuring that products arrive on time and in the right condition.
The importance of comprehensive logistics in supply chain management
When we talk about optimizing the supply chain, comprehensive logistics becomes an essential component. This term refers to the coordinated management of all logistics activities, from transportation to logistics storage, in order to provide a smooth and efficient service. Comprehensive logistics not only improves the flow of products but also reduces delivery times and optimizes the use of available resources.
For example, in an operation that requires storage in multiple geographic locations, comprehensive logistics allows for efficient management of the product flow between warehouses, minimizing the risk of shortages or excess inventory. By having centralized control over logistics operations, you can also respond more quickly and effectively to unforeseen events or changes in demand.
The role of logistics storage in the supply chain
Logistics storage is one of the areas that most influences the efficiency of supply chain management. Proper warehouse management allows you to maintain a balanced inventory, reduce wait times, and ensure that products are ready for distribution when needed.
Optimizing storage involves using advanced technologies such as warehouse management systems (WMS), which allow you to control inventory in real-time, accurately track products, and reduce human errors. Additionally, automation in warehouses helps lower operating costs and improves accuracy in picking and packing operations.
In short, proper management of logistics storage allows you to improve not only the internal efficiency of the company but also the level of customer service by ensuring that products are available when needed and in the right conditions.
